A must see! We just happened to drive by on a Saturday late afternoon, when I noticed this rock house. I told my friend, we must go back and see this House, I'd like to sneak a few photo's. Well then as I went around the block to park I noticed it was a museum. Unfortunately it had already closed. But I love rocks, stones, natural things, so we got out of the car so I could take some photo's of this amazing place. I couldn't believe there was even petrified wood! The more I got closer to the house I had to touch the house to see if this is for real! But it was. The entire house, gate and garage is covered in natural stones from all over Oklahoma, Texas, Kansas and Colorado. It was quite beautiful. The more I went around this house the more I fell in love. As we started to head toward the back and under the rock arbor gate, a man came out. At first I thought he would kick us off the property, but oh no, not in Oklahoma, especially a city like Enid, Oklahoma. He was not only very kind, he explained some details about the house and the museum as we walked all around the outside of the property. Then much to our surprise, he invited us inside for a private tour! Oh my goodness, I was so thrilled to see and learn all the details about this house and why and how it became this incredible rock house and now a museum. The inside has multiple details and many historic stories to share. Next time your in Enid, Oklahoma stop in and visit this quaint museum. Its a short tour and well worth it. Check out open and closing times because I'm not sure everyone is as lucky as we were to get the private tour. Thank you to the curator who gave us this wonderful tour. Much appreciated.
